Dar Orders Intensified Efforts for Release of Pakistani Hostages

Islamabad: Deputy Prime Minister Ishaq Dar has mandated the intensification of efforts to secure the release of ten Pakistani hostages taken by pirates off the Somali coast. Chairing a high-level meeting in Islamabad, he emphasized the need for close coordination with both national and international entities to facilitate the hostages’ safe return.

According to Radio Pakistan, Dar instructed relevant stakeholders to enhance diplomatic engagement with Somali authorities and international organizations. He reaffirmed the government’s commitment to the situation and expressed solidarity with the hostages’ families, voicing optimism that sustained efforts would yield a positive outcome. The hostages were aboard the MT Honour 25 when it was hijacked.
